Main Objective



To provide end-to-end HR support, ensuring consistent and effective delivery of HR services across the organisation.

Key Responsibilities



HR Administration



Maintain accurate and up-to-date employee records.

Prepare HR documentation including contracts, letters, and reports.

Support payroll processes with timely and accurate HR data.

Recruitment & Onboarding



Support recruitment in partnership with the Talent Acquisition Specialist.

Organise and facilitate onboarding and induction programmes.

Sickness Absence Management



Monitor and report on absence trends.

Coach managers on absence reviews and return-to-work interviews.

Ensure compliance with policies and statutory requirements.

Performance Management



Assist with performance appraisal processes.

Provide guidance on objectives and underperformance.

Support development plans and improvement strategies.

Employee Relations



Provide first-line advice on HR policies and employment law.

Support investigations, disciplinary, grievance, and capability processes.

Advice & Guidance



Act as a point of contact for HR queries.

Offer consistent HR advice aligned with company policies.

Escalate complex issues to senior HR colleagues.

Employee Engagement



Support initiatives to enhance engagement and wellbeing.

Assist with surveys and action plans.

Promote a positive workplace culture through our Arthrex Proud strategy.

Talent & Succession Planning



Contribute to talent identification and succession planning.

Maintain records of key talent and development needs.

Support career development conversations.

Learning & Development



Coordinate training activities and maintain records.

Support delivery of learning programmes.

Evaluate training effectiveness.

Organisational Change



Assist with organisational design and change programmes.

Support consultation processes and documentation.

Ensure compliance with legal requirements.

HR Systems & Reporting



Maintain and update HR systems.

Produce HR reports and analytics.

Support data integrity and system improvements.
